Corporal Robert Nenke
Submitted by admin on Thu, 05/21/2015 - 12:55
Corporal Robert Nenke, was born at Nuriootpa, South Australia, on 14 November 1893. He enlisted at Adelaide on 18 August 1914 and served at Gallipoli, Alexandria and France. He was wounded in action in France on 28 August 1917 and again on 7 August 1918. He died from his wounds on 8 August 1918. He is buried in the Crouy British Cemetery, Crouy-sur-Somme.
Photographs taken by Cpl Nenke
Submitted by Joannad on Mon, 01/15/2018 - 09:04
A collection of photographs taken by Robert Nenke during his service is at the Australian War Memorial. See: https://www.awm.gov.au/collection/P10679396
